In today’s digital age, mobile applications have become an essential part of our daily lives. Whether you want to build an app for your business, a personal project, or to tap into a booming market, there are numerous app building software options available. In this comprehensive guide, we’ll explore the top app building software solutions, offering a variety of options to meet your needs. From no-code platforms suitable for beginners to professional-level tools for experienced developers, you’ll find the right fit for your app development journey.
1. Appy Pie
Appy Pie is a popular no-code app builder that caters to beginners and non-technical users. It offers a simple drag-and-drop interface, making it easy to create basic apps, from event apps to restaurant menus. While it’s user-friendly, it may have limitations for complex app projects.
Adalo is a versatile no-code platform that provides greater flexibility for app creation. It allows you to design custom apps with various data sources, including databases, APIs, and more. You can create apps for various purposes, from e-commerce to social networking.
Thunkable is another no-code app building platform, known for its user-friendly interface and a wide range of pre-built components. You can create Android and iOS apps without writing a single line of code. It’s a great choice for prototyping and simple app building software.
Bubble is a no-code platform that focuses on web application development. It offers powerful features for creating web apps with databases, workflows, and user authentication. While it’s not ideal for mobile app development, it’s a strong choice for web-based projects.
AppSheet, now a part of Google Cloud, provides a no-code platform to build apps connected to Google Workspace and other data sources. It’s a great option if you’re already using Google services and want to streamline your app creation process.
Moving beyond no-code platforms, OutSystems is a low-code app development solution. It’s suitable for those with some technical background and offers more customization options. You can build complex applications with integrations, automation, and scalability.
7. Microsoft Power Apps
Microsoft Power Apps is part of the Microsoft Power Platform and is designed for business users to create custom apps. It integrates seamlessly with other Microsoft services like SharePoint and Excel, making it a great choice for enterprises.
Mendix is a low-code platform that provides an excellent balance between customization and ease of use. It’s ideal for creating apps for various industries, including healthcare, finance, and manufacturing. Mendix offers AI and machine learning capabilities to enhance your apps.
Flutter, developed by Google, is a popular open-source SDK for building natively compiled applications for mobile, web, and desktop from a single codebase. It’s a great choice for developers who want to create high-performance, visually appealing apps.
10. React Native
Tips for Successful App Building Software
Define Your App’s Purpose: Start by clearly defining the purpose of your app, its target audience, and the problems it aims to solve.
Plan Your User Experience (UX): Create a user-friendly interface that provides a seamless experience for your app users.
Use Visual Elements: Incorporate appealing visuals, icons, and images to make your app visually engaging.
Test Your App: Continuously test your app to identify and fix any bugs or issues.
Stay Updated: Keep up with the latest trends and technologies in app development to enhance your app’s functionality.
Seek Feedback: Gather feedback from potential users to make improvements and ensure your app meets their needs.
Promote Your App: Develop a marketing strategy to reach your target audience and promote your app effectively.
Whether you’re a beginner or an experienced developer, there’s an app building software solution for you. Choose the platform that best aligns with your skills and project requirements, and follow the tips provided to ensure a successful app development journey. With the right tools and knowledge, you can turn your app idea into a reality, making a mark in the digital world.